If you’re looking for a home that’s simple, stylish and ready to go, this one-bedroom ground floor apartment on Heycroft Way in Chelmsford could be exactly what you’ve been waiting for.

Offered with no onward chain, this is the kind of property that keeps things straightforward — no long waits, no complicated moves, just a smooth step onto the ladder (or a smart addition to a portfolio).

Being on the ground floor, the apartment offers easy, practical living — ideal whether you’re looking for convenience, accessibility or just a layout that works day-to-day.

Inside, the lounge is a great space to settle into. Bright, comfortable and versatile, it’s the kind of room that adapts to your lifestyle — from relaxed evenings to hosting friends without feeling cramped.

The kitchen is neatly arranged and functional, making the most of the space with everything close at hand — perfect for everyday cooking without the fuss.

The bedroom provides a cosy and well-proportioned retreat, while the bathroom, complete with a full-size bath, keeps things practical and ready for both quick mornings and slower evenings.

Outside, the property quietly ticks some big boxes. There’s residents parking, plus the added bonus of an allocated garage — ideal for storage, a car, or just that extra bit of space everyone ends up needing.

A long lease adds further peace of mind, making this a solid option whether you’re buying your first home, downsizing, or investing.

Location-wise, you’re well placed to enjoy everything Chelmsford has to offer — from shopping and dining to excellent transport links via Chelmsford railway station, making commuting into London straightforward.

Located within a well-regarded residential area of Chelmsford, Heycroft Way benefits from a peaceful setting while remaining close to the city’s vibrant amenities. Chelmsford is one of Essex’s most desirable locations, offering a strong mix of shopping, dining and leisure facilities, including the popular Bond Street Chelmsford development and bustling High Street. For commuters, Chelmsford railway station provides fast and direct services into London Liverpool Street, while nearby road links such as the A12 ensure excellent connectivity. The area is also well served by local parks, schools and everyday conveniences, making it a well-rounded choice for professionals, first-time buyers and investors alike.

Material Information:

Annual Service Charge: £960.00
Annual Ground Rent: tbc
Length of Lease: 946 years remaining
